From: http://www.ietf.org/ietf-ftp/IPR/NOKIA-RFC3095.txt

Received April 23, 2002
From: harri.honkasalo@nokia.com

This is to advise the IETF that Nokia believes it owns patents and patent applications
which may relate to RFC 3095, including:

1) "CID field handling in ROHC": FI 20002100, US 09/954562, PCT/FI01/00819
2) "Variable length context identifier for real time header compression":
  FI 20002307, US 09/978479, PCT/FI01/00902
3) "Variable length encoding of compressed data": US 09/536638, US 60/164330,
  PCT/US00/41773
4) "A timer-based scheme for efficient and robust compression of RTP time stamp":
  US 09/377913, US 09/522363, PCT/US01/07573
5) "Robust and efficient compression of list of items": US 09/756232, US 60/211986,
  PCT/US01/50525
6) "Using sparse feedback to increase bandwidth efficiency in high delay, low bandwidth
  environment": US 09/434384, PCT/US00/29846
7) "Header compression in real time services": CN 00803936.4, EP 00905087.3, FI 990335,
  FI-PAT 108588, JP 2000600378, US 09/505643, PCT/FI00/00107
8) "Using periodic acknowledgements and adaptive coding for maintaining
  synchronization in error and loss-prone environments": US 09/536639, US 60/159360,
  PCT/US00/28326

Please refer to http://www.ietf.org/ietf/IPR/NOKIA for more details.
